## Firmware Update Channel

The Quillware Device Hub exposes a dedicated firmware update channel for plugin authors who need to stage, verify, and promote firmware bundles to enrolled devices. Each request to the `/firmware/channels` endpoint must declare a target ring (canary, beta, or stable) and a signed manifest digest; mismatched digests are rejected before any device is notified. Rate limits apply per plugin, not per device fleet. All calls must be authenticated with the bearer token shown below.

session JWT of hahif-fawif = eyJhbGciOiJIUzI1NiIsInR5cCI6IkpXVCJ9.eyJzdWIiOiI04_V2KayaDIn0.-jKHPhS5t5LS

Ticket #4417 — Expired creds blocking profile-store shard migration

Hey, quick one before the release cut: the credential the Shardling migration tool uses to talk to the Ledgerbee profile store expired over the weekend, so the phase-two shard split is stalled at 40%. I've already minted a replacement with the same scopes, valid 60 days. Can you drop it into the release config before tonight's window? New key is below.

service key, fawip-bajef: kto11_Qt5wZK9vdNC

### Postmortem follow-up: stale-cache fix for Ottershelf

This PR closes out the action items from last week's stale-cache incident. Root cause: the invalidation worker used a longer TTL than the read path assumed, so profile edits could appear to "unsave" for up to ten minutes. Fix is twofold — single source of truth for TTLs, plus a jittered refresh so we don't stampede the origin. The unified constants this PR introduces are shown below.

constants for yajof-hadup:
RATE_LIMITS = {
    "druael": 2,
    "ralael": 10,
}